Solve each compound inequality
Please show work.
x-6>-14 and x/4<0

We have the following inequations:
 x-6> -14
 x / 4 <0
 We solve each one separately:
 For x-6> -14:
 
x-6> -14
 x> -14 + 6
 x> -8
 For x / 4 <0:
 
x / 4 <0
 x <4 * 0
 x <0
 The final result is the following compound inequality: -8
 -8 <x <0
 Answer:
 
-8 <x <0
